Thanks for looking at the blog Dave G and thanks for your kind remarks….I certainly agree that by returning to specific subjects repeatedly you are able to build on what’s gone before. Its often a conversation with yourself in terms of taking it forward or not….. and its not always always better every time you return but often you are able to make better individual images because of past experience. Also you go on to develop a body of work that collectively is certainly much stronger than any one off. Today Im again working on taxis from taxis…….
